21 January 2024 - Treatment for advanced melanoma is set to become cheaper under the Pharmaceutical Benefits Scheme in the coming weeks.

Health Minister Mark Butler announced today that patients aged over 12 and living with recurrent or metastatic melanoma will be reimbursed for Opdualag (nivolumab, relatlimab).
